Salary in Healthcare in Singapore

Market pay levels based on 4 226 offers with salary.

Browse vacancies

Recalculated from open vacancies where the employer states pay.

Median5 145 $Half of offers pay more, half pay less
Average5 154 $Arithmetic mean of all offers
Lower quartile4 416 $25% of offers pay less
Upper quartile5 930 $25% of offers pay more

What the numbers mean

  • Half of all offers fall between 4 416 $ and 5 930 $.
  • Every fourth offer pays more than 5 930 $.
  • The upper quartile is 34% above the lower one.
  • The average is close to the median, so offers are spread evenly.
  • The estimate uses 4 226 vacancies with a stated salary.

Frequently asked questions

Why show the median instead of the average?

The median (5 145 $) is the middle of the market: half of the offers pay more and half pay less. Unlike the average (5 154 $), it is not skewed by a handful of very high salaries.

What does the typical range mean?

From 4 416 $ to 5 930 $ is the middle half of all offers — the 25th to 75th percentile. A quarter of vacancies pay below 4 416 $ and a quarter above 5 930 $.

Where does the data come from?

From 4 226 open vacancies with a stated salary that Finder collects from public sources. Numbers are recalculated as the selection changes.

How we calculate salaries

Short methodology and the data behind these numbers.

  1. 1We collect offersOnly vacancies from open sources where the employer states pay are used.
  2. 2We normalise themA salary range is reduced to one comparable value per vacancy.
  3. 3We compute percentilesMedian, quartiles and the average are calculated from at least 5 offers; otherwise the wider country market is shown.
  4. 4We refresh the numbersStatistics are recomputed as new vacancies appear and closed ones drop out.

Figures are pay as published by employers: taxes, bonuses and seniority inside a grade are not accounted for.
